1. **State the problem:** Calculate the value of the expression $$8 \times 3 + 70 \div 7 - 7$$. 2. **Recall the order of operations:** Use PEMDAS/BODMAS rules: Parentheses, Exponents, Multiplication and Division (left to right), Addition and Subtraction (left to right). 3. **Calculate multiplication and division first:** - $$8 \times 3 = 24$$ - $$70 \div 7 = 10$$ 4. **Rewrite the expression with these values:** $$24 + 10 - 7$$ 5. **Perform addition and subtraction from left to right:** - $$24 + 10 = 34$$ - $$34 - 7 = 27$$ 6. **Final answer:** $$27$$
